Caulerpa spp. is a genus of fast-growing macroalgae commonly used in marine aquariums to improve water quality and provide natural habitat complexity. This extra large specimen comes attached to live rock, making it easy to place within your aquarium.
Lighting: Moderate to high lighting is recommended to support healthy growth and vibrant coloration.
Water Flow: Moderate water flow helps prevent detritus accumulation on the algae and encourages healthy development.
Placement: Position Caulerpa spp. in areas with sufficient light and water movement, avoiding direct contact with corals that may be sensitive to its growth or chemical exudates. Provide adequate spacing to prevent overgrowth onto neighbouring corals.
Care Level: Suitable for hobbyists with some experience in maintaining stable water parameters. Regular pruning is advised to control growth and prevent it from overtaking the tank.
Compatibility: Generally reef safe with caution, as some species may produce compounds that inhibit coral growth. Monitor interactions closely.
Additional Notes: Caulerpa spp. can help reduce nitrate and phosphate levels, contributing to overall tank health. Avoid introduction into tanks with herbivorous fish or invertebrates that may excessively graze on the algae.
